Question Bluetooth and Navigation F150 Platinum SCREW

Hello everyone,

I was wondering if the following symptoms were just me, or if others were experiencing the same problem.

I have my iPhone synched with the bluetooth on the truck.

When I use the navigation and the bluetooth at the same time, the navigation voice overrides the phone sound.

In other words, I would be on a conversation via the bluetooth, and when the next instruction for direction is announced from the navigation, it would completely mute the phone conversation!!!!!

I've had 3 other cars with built-in navigation (Acura TL, Infiniti FX35 and Nissan Pathfinder) and bluetooth, but it never muted the phone conversation.

Is there a way to disable this? Or using both navi and phone is just not meant to be?

Not the behavior exhibited by my KR. The directions are muted while I am on the phone (nav does do the "dings" to alert you to turns, which mites the call- annoying, but not overly so) There is probably a setting somewhere to change the behavior.
